    In 203 BC, Qin cut Zhao Tuo into Lingnan, established the South Vietnamese state, and built the palace palace in Panyu (now Guangzhou) in the capital. The site of the Nanyue Palace Office not only contains the Nanyue Palace Garden, but also the relics from Qin, Han, Jin, Nan Dynasty, Yuan, Ming and Qing Dynasty, etc. These relics overlapped layers and formed a non-word history book that recorded the development of Guangzhou for more than 2,000 years. The unique design, exquisite construction and grand scale of the large stone structure pool and meandering stone canal in the Royal Garden of the Nanyue National Palace is amazing. This site has been rated as the top ten archaeological discoveries in the country twice, which is of great value to the study of ancient architecture and ancient gardens. Ququ Canal to the south into "a few" domineering Ququ Canal about 180 meters long, from north to south, then to the east, injected a curved moon stone pool and then continued to flow west, the total area of more than 13,000 square meters. On the paving slab at the bottom of the canal, a layer of gray black river pebbles is arranged, and the yellow and white large pebbles are also used to be "the" word. What is inexplicable is that this channel, which is mainly used to view the stream, hides a mystery. Experts found that the direction of Quququ is also a "several" word. The palace was originally a high-rise building, the base of the table is surrounded by brick, the outside of the base of the water is beautifully printed with generous bricks and small pebbles paved, and the outside is covered with side bricks, the overall production is very elegant. The Grand Palace of the South Han Dynasty On the same formation, not only can you see the South Vietnamese Palace Department, but also have the honor to see the large palace relics of the South Han Dynasty discovered by archaeologists accidentally during the excavation of the site of the South Vietnamese Palace Department. In the cultural layer of the southern Han Dynasty, archaeologists found 36 giant piers (pillar foundations) used to carry pillars, the palace building area of nearly 1,000 square meters, you can imagine the palace was very grand at the time. In the west of the palace, another group of palace foundations and brick floors were found, and the north of the platform was paved with beautifully decorated square bricks, which are currently only excavated to the east of the palace.

    The site of the Nanyue Palace: The story about it will be said more than 2,000 years ago. After Qin Shihuang unified the six countries, he sent the Huo leader to attack and unify Lingnan, and Ren Huo became the first Nanhai County Lieutenant. At the end of Qin, Ren Huo was seriously ill and handed over his post to his strong general Zhao Yu, and instructed him to take advantage of the war in the Central Plains and support the soldiers. Zhao Yu established the South Vietnamese state in 203 BC, and built the palace palace in the center of Panyu (now Guangzhou), the site is located on Zhongshan 4th Road, Guangzhou. The Nanyue Palace is mainly composed of a large stone structure pool and meandering stone canal, similar to the stone structure of ancient Rome, and the style of the wooden structure or brick structure of ancient China's Central Plains region is very different. In addition to the relics of the Qin Dynasty, there are cultural relics from the Han, Jin, Southern Dynasty, Sui, Tang, Nanhan, Song, Yuan, Ming, Qing to the Republic of China and other historical dynasties. They are like a wordless history book, which shows us the development history of Guangzhou for more than 2,000 years. I was most impressed by the wells of different dynasties, the oldest of which is the water brick wells in the South Vietnamese country, and there is still water in the well, although it is not clear.     Now known as the Nanyue Palace Museum, next to the museum is Chenghuang Temple. The main display content of the Nanyue Palace Museum is the Nanyue Palace Palace and the site of the Nanhan Palace in the fifth generation period. It can be seen that after more than 2,000 years of vicissitudes, the location of the center of Guangzhou has basically not changed. The ancient remains in the modern high-rise buildings give physical testimony, which has a unique charm. The original site of the museum is a children's park. In 2003, the government invested heavily in the land to start archaeological excavation and build a museum. It seems that economic strength is definitely the guarantee of cultural relics protection. The museum receives free tickets to visit, there are four main buildings, the main building of the Quliu Stone Canal Site Protection (relict of the palace drainage system), the Nanhan Palace Site Protection Exhibition Hall (the floor tiles are very exquisite), the display building (including the Nanyue Palace Showcase, the Nanhan Palace Showcase and the famous city Guangzhou 2000s showroom three Sub-content), Guangzhou ancient well display building (text pictures, relics). Many relics (palace sites, Qin shipbuilding sites) are protected by backfill method. The museum takes at least half a day to see in detail. The museum's exhibition halls have regular explanations and will have broadcast announcements, which is very human. From the Guangzhou 2000 exhibition, Guangzhou's place name began in the Three Kingdoms period, Sun Quan Huangwu five years (AD 226) divided Jiaozhou South China Sea, Cangwu, Yulin, Hepu four counties to Guangzhou, Zhisuo Panyu, from now on, this place is called Guangzhou.
